Definitions

  • the present disclosure relates to a media applicator and a system and method for applying media.
  • Media applicators and systems for applying media are known.
  • Known systems such as paint spraying systems for paint lines, include such applicators for dispensing media, such as paint colors, and applying them to surfaces to be painted or target surfaces.
  • Media applicators for applying several different media, particularly different paint colors, are also known.
  • different media often require different application modes, which cannot easily be implemented with a single media applicator.
  • An object of the embodiments of the present disclosure is to provide a media applicator and a system and method for applying media, which enable different media to be applied in a simple manner in a media-specific or user- and/or application-specific manner.
  • the media applicator can, in particular, be designed to dispense one or more media in order to apply the medium(s) to a target surface, if necessary by means of a spray head or outlet nozzle connected to the outlet side.
  • the media applicator can be configured to dispense two different media simultaneously. A mixture of the two media can advantageously form in the spray head.
  • the spray head or outlet nozzle can, in particular, be designed as part of the media applicator or as a separate part.
  • the media applicator can, in particular, be designed in the form of a bell or gun of a painting system in order to dispense one or more paint colors as media and apply them to a surface to be painted or to a target surface.
  • the media applicator can be further configured in that the spray head comprises a first spray unit and a second spray unit, and wherein the first media outlet discharges the first medium into the first spray unit and wherein the second media outlet discharges the second medium into the second spray unit, so that the first medium can be applied by means of the first spray unit of the spray head and the second medium can be applied by means of the second spray unit of the spray head.
  • the media supply lines can comprise at least one branch that can be separated by means of at least one valve.
  • the media supply lines can be designed so that the media can be fed serially, one after the other, or sequentially into a common media inlet.
  • the at least one separable branch can be separated, for example, before a media change. This can, in particular, prevent the media from mixing in the region of the at least one separable branch despite shared use of the media inlet.
  • the spray units of the spray head can in particular be designed to be operated independently of one another and to apply the at least one first medium and the at least one second medium in a media-specific or application-specific manner.
  • different media with different application modes can be applied flexibly using a single media applicator.
  • the base body 2 further comprises a rinsing agent supply line 12, which is connected to a rinsing agent inlet 13 at the first end 3 of the base body 2, and an air line 14, which is connected to an air inlet 15 at the first end 3 of the base body 2.
  • the media applicator 1 has valves 16, 16a and 17, an air ring 18 or adapter at the second end 3 of the base body and a cover 19.
  • the base body 2 has a further detergent supply line, which can be controlled by means of the valve 16a and which leads to the rinsing agent outlet 9a.
  • the first media chamber 22 can be rinsed by means of the rinsing agent outlet 9a.
  • the media supply lines 11 comprise a substantially axially extending central media supply line 11a and a peripherally extending decentralized media supply line 11b.
  • the valves 16, 17 comprise a decentralized main needle valve 16 for opening and closing the decentralized media supply line 11b and a central main needle valve 17 for opening and closing the central media supply line 11a.
  • the media applicator 1 comprises a spray head 20 coupled to the air ring 18 at the second end 4 of the base body 2.
  • the spray head 20 is designed in the form of a dual rotary atomizer bell and has a first spray unit 21 with a first media chamber 22 and a second spray unit 23 with a second media chamber 24.
  • the first spray unit 21 is substantially annular and encloses the second spray unit 23, which is axially centrally positioned.
  • the first media outlet 9 opens into the first media chamber 22 of the first spray unit 21 and the second media outlet 10 opens into the second media chamber 24 of the second spray unit 23.
  • a turbine blocking device 25 is also provided for blocking or locking and unblocking or unlocking the air turbine 6.
  • Fig. 2 shows a schematic cross section through a media applicator according to a second embodiment.
  • the second embodiment essentially corresponds to the first Example according to Fig. 1 , wherein the decentralized media supply line 11b is designed as a branch of the central media supply line 11a.
  • the media applicator 1 according to Fig. 2 no separate media inlet for the decentralized media supply line 11b.
  • the decentralized media supply line 11b and the central media supply line 11a are designed so that the two media supply lines 11a and 11b can be supplied via the central media inlet 8 and the central main needle valve 17, respectively.
  • Fig. 3 shows a schematic cross section through a media applicator according to a third embodiment.
  • the third embodiment essentially corresponds to the first embodiment of the Fig. 1 , wherein the second inner spray unit 23 of the spray head 20 is designed as an air atomizer with horn air and atomizer air.
  • Fig. 4 shows a schematic cross section through a media applicator according to a fourth embodiment.
  • the fourth embodiment essentially corresponds to the embodiment of Fig. 2 , wherein the media applicator 1 comprises a device according to the third embodiment ( Fig. 3 ) formed spray head 20.
  • the media supply lines can be connected to the media connection 8 of the media applicator according to Figures 2 and 4 or at the media connections 7 and 8 of the media applicator according to Figures 1 and 3 be connected.
  • the media supply unit or the media supply lines can be designed such that at least one first medium and at least one second medium can be provided for the media applicator.
  • the at least one first medium can be introduced into the decentralized media line 11b via the first media inlet 7 and guided to the first media outlet 9 of the media applicator 1.
  • the valve 16 or the decentralized main needle valve the media supply to the first media inlet 9 can be regulated or interrupted if necessary.
  • the at least one second medium can be introduced into the central media line 11a via the second media inlet 8 and guided to the second media outlet 10 of the media applicator 1.
  • the media supply to the second media inlet 10 can be regulated or interrupted if necessary.
  • the two media can be dispensed via separate media outlets 9 and 10.
  • the two media can be introduced into the media inlets 7 and 8 essentially simultaneously.
  • the media(s) are fed into the media applicator 1 via the central second media inlet 8.
  • a medium can be fed in via the media inlet 8
  • the inlet can extend to the front of the bell and from there a second line can lead back and into the media supply line 11.
  • the same medium can be fed via both outlets 9 and 10.
  • a first medium can be dispensed via the first outlet 9 and a second medium can be dispensed via the second outlet 10 in a time-coupled manner.
  • the media(s) can be directed to separate spray units by feeding the media(s) serially or sequentially to the media applicator.
  • valve 16 can be closed and the medium or a mixed medium can be introduced into the central media supply line 11a. Since valve 16 closes the decentralized media supply line, the second medium cannot reach the first media outlet 9 but only the second media outlet 10. Thus, the medium is guided via the common media inlet 8 to separate media outlets 9 and 10, so that the two spray units 21 and 22 can be supplied separately.
  • At least one first medium can be fed into the media applicator.
  • the at least one first medium can be in the case of a media applicator according to Figures 1 and 3 be introduced into the decentralized media supply line 11b via the first media inlet 7.
  • the at least one first medium can reach the first media outlet 9 via the central media inlet 8 and via the decentralized media supply line 11b (when the valve 16 is open).
  • the first spray unit 21 of the media applicator 1 can be supplied with the at least one first medium via the first media outlet 9, which opens into the first media space 22 of the first spray unit 21.
  • At least one second medium can be fed into the media applicator.
  • the at least one second medium can be introduced into the central media supply line 11a via the second media inlet 8.
  • the valve 16 can be closed so that the at least one second medium cannot reach the first media chamber 22 of the first spray unit.
  • the method 100 may include applying 130 the at least one first medium using the first spray unit 21 or the first rotary atomizer bell of the spray head 20.
  • a medium can be applied using a rotary atomization method, which represents a suitable application method for many applications or media.
  • a plurality of different first media can be applied using the first spray unit.
  • the method 100 may also include applying 140 the at least one second medium by means of the second spray unit 21 of the spray head 20.
  • the second spray unit 23 is also designed as a rotary atomizer bell, so that the second medium can also be applied in a rotary atomization process.
  • the second spray unit is designed as an air atomizer with horn air and atomizer air.
  • atomization by means of an air atomizer with horn air and atomizer air represents a more suitable alternative to the rotary atomization process.
  • media applicator 1 according to Figures 3 and 4 The two different processes can therefore be used for the two different media.
  • the media applicator described above different media can be applied flexibly and conveniently with a single applicator.
  • the media can be applied using dedicated spray units or units designed for the respective application or medium, and the spray heads can also be easily replaced if necessary.
